SKILLS & EXPERIENCE

  • Degree qualified in Electrical Engineering or equivalent qualifications and experience.
  • Chartered Engineer through the IET.
  • Strong understanding and leadership of the engineering projects through asset lifecycles.
  • Track record of leading teams in the delivery of FEED or detailed design of EHV (132kV upwards) substation projects.
  • TP141 or equivalent authorised or ability to do so.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with internal and external stakeholders.
  • Maintain existing and develop new client relationships.
  • Experience in a leadership/management position in a similar environment, including coaching/mentoring junior engineers.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provide Leadership on the FEED and detail design workstream for Transmission and Distribution clients.
  • Ensure adequate quality assurance and delivery of FEED, Detailed design and bids.
  • Ensure adequate resources and training of resources for the purposes of delivering FEED and detailed design work.
  • Act as TP141/Assurance Engineer where required.
  • Review the HV plant aspects of different projects including HV layouts, earthing design and reports, mechanical interlocking, HV busbar calculations and technical specification for the HV plant equipment.
  • Coordination with engineers, sub-contractors and suppliers as required.
  • Manage tender packages as tender manager and doing HV plant aspects of technical offers.
  • Attend and chair the design review and Hazard review meetings and reviewing HV plant design packages.
  • Attending site visits, FAT and SAT as required.
  • Strong communication skills along with teamworking attributes.
  • Identify customer needs and develop business relationships.
